As other reviewers have noted, The Essex Inn is everything you always dreamed B&Bs would be, but seldom are. The Essex is perfect--beautiful house, tastefully and creatively decorated, spacious rooms with excellent bathrooms, and the most delicious and wonderfully presented breakfasts. Bob and Janice are welcoming, helpful, and interesting hosts.

Official Description (provided by the hotel):
Four rooms and four suites all with en suite bathrooms, luxurious amenities and Wi-Fi. All have working fireplaces, cable TV, air conditioning, hair dryers, irons, luxurious linens and plenty of oversized soft towels. Guests have access to a refrigerator and microwave, a screened-in porch and a private brick courtyard for outdoor relaxation and smoking. Wi-Fi is available throughout the property. A full, three-course breakfast is included along with afternoon snacks, wine and beer. ... more   less
